A facile one‐pot three‐component coupling (3CC) of indoles, aldehydes, and N ‐alkyl anilines has been attained using a catalytic quantity of molecular iodine under neutral conditions to afford 3‐aminoalkyl indoles at room temperature. The salient features of this method are the mild reaction conditions, the operational simplicity of the method, outstanding yields in moderately at short reaction times and low cost of the catalyst.
